The indomitable Dervla Murphy (sadly, no longer with us) and her then 6 year old daughter, Rachel, described by Murphy as "a natural stoic, well able to walk ten or twelve miles a day without flagging", undertake a winter trek by pony and on foot across 5 valleys in Baltistan. 259 pages printed and bound on terracotta-coloured boards, plus list of equipment, a good bibliography and Index.
